Outside of music, Taylor Swift is widely known for her sparkling red-carpet outfits and stage looks. But she also has a strong street style, as seen during her New York City strolls over the years. Swift seems to be a fan of statement coats, patterned tights and denim ensembles.
This week, The Eras Tour songstress marked the return of the “summer skort” as she stepped out in the style – twice – in New York. CNN even deemed it a “look of the week” for its functional and fashionable sensibilities.
Let’s take a look at her style evolution from the 2010s till now …
1. Preppy chic

Swift, 33, has been in the spotlight since the mid 2000s, but her street style really started to stand out in the 2010s.
For a New York City outing in November 2011, for example, Swift tucked a navy, cable-knit jumper by Ralph Lauren into a pleated yellow skirt from ModCloth. Her academia-esque look was completed with magenta Marc Jacobs kitten heels, red lipstick, and a blue Fendi purse that matched the sparkling 13 drawn on her hand.
2. Daring cut-outs

In particular, 2014, was a big year for Swift’s fashion in the lead up to her album 1989. She wore lots of crop tops and miniskirts at the time, like this gray two-piece set from Alice + Olivia.
Still, it was her accessories that made her looks like the above truly stand out. She wore vibrant pink pumps designed by Christian Louboutin and carried a yellow version of Dolce & Gabbana’s Linda Tote bag.
3. The kitty ‘accessory’

She had fun with accessories that year … including unconventional ones like her cat Olivia.
She carried her cat on a September day in New York City while wearing a classically preppy look. The “Love Story” singer tucked a white Free People top adorned with lace sleeves into a plaid skirt from RD Style, and completed the look with a maroon pair of sheer knee-highs by Tabbisocks.
Swift also wore black loafer pumps from & Other Stories and carried a green Dolce & Gabbana bag.
4. Stand-out coats

A long-time fashion staple of Swift’s, stand-out coats also played a part in her 1989 wardrobe.
Less than a month after her fifth studio album was released, Swift was photographed spending time with Karlie Kloss in New York City.
She wore a little black dress underneath a tan, tattersall coat, sheer polka dot tights and lace-up heeled Oxfords. Swift also carried a burgundy purse and sported a thin gold headband adorned with a small bow.
5. Cute and tailored

By 2015, Swift had adopted tank tops and tailored shorts.
For one outing in May 2015, Swift wore an open-back tank top from Zara with black-and-white printed shorts from River Island. She also added blue patent-leather heels from Pedro Garcia for a pop of colour, Swarovski sunglasses and a Mary Katrantzou bag.
6. The rocker phase

But in 2016, Swift’s street style had a brief rocker period. Not only had the musician chopped her long locks in favour of a bleached bob, but she also wore edgier clothes for a brief time.
In May 2016, she was photographed leaving a gathering at Anna Wintour’s home while wearing a plaid Louis Vuitton dress with chunky boots and a leather jacket – both from the fashion house. For accessories, she chose only a small black purse designed by Mark Cross.

7. Denim days

Eventually, she returned to vibrant colours and denim garments. In August 2016, Swift walked around New York City while wearing a pink Brandy Melville tank top underneath a denim, overall-style dress from Tularosa. She also sported a black Marni bag and flower-printed trainers from Gucci.
8. Glam girl

She also hinted at her glamorous red-carpet style with her nighttime looks. One evening in September 2016, Swift was photographed wearing a black V-neck Aritzia bodysuit worn underneath a white miniskirt from Related Apparel.
But her accessories really made the outfit. Swift wore strappy sandals from Louise et Cie, a tan clutch by Aspinal of London and a white choker necklace from Adornmonde.
